Output 54ec55a4f17e813f3d95effe93f113e4287b2881ce03c666235553ab5baae571:2

value
3443543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d91eaad46c0f28c9e0c4123cb83b5a5ca850d6 OP_EQUAL
address
3CAH4AF8kBsXhEwbQhAgzySRLU76HZaATP
transaction
54ec55a4f17e813f3d95effe93f113e4287b2881ce03c666235553ab5baae571
confirmations
468749
spent
true